centos

CentOS Java开发工具推荐

小樊
49
2025-05-02 17:56:31
栏目: 编程语言

在CentOS系统上进行Java开发,通常需要以下工具:

  1. JDK (Java Development Kit)

    • 推荐版本:OpenJDK 8 或 11,这些版本在CentOS上广泛使用且稳定。
    • 安装方法
      • 使用yum安装:
        sudo yum install java-1.8.0-openjdk-devel
        
      • 手动安装:
        • 下载JDK安装包(例如JDK 1.8):
          wget https://download.oracle.com/otn-pub/java/jdk/8u281-linux-x64_bin.tar.gz
          
        • 解压安装包:
          tar -zxvf jdk-8u281-linux-x64.tar.gz
          
        • 移动解压后的文件夹到指定目录(例如/usr/local/java):
          sudo mv jdk1.8.0_281 /usr/local/java
          
      • 配置环境变量:
        • 编辑/etc/profile文件:
          sudo vi /etc/profile
          
        • 在文件末尾添加以下内容(替换为实际的JDK安装路径):
          export JAVA_HOME=/usr/local/java/jdk1.8.0_281
          export PATH=$JAVA_HOME/bin:$PATH
          export CLASSPATH=.:$JAVA_HOME/jre/lib/ext:$JAVA_HOME/lib/tools.jar
          
        • 使环境变量生效:
          source /etc/profile
          
      • 验证安装:
        java -version
        
        如果显示了JDK的安装路径和Java的版本信息,则说明配置成功。
  2. 文本编辑器

    • 推荐:Vim、Nano
    • 用途:用于编写Java源代码文件。
  3. 命令行工具

    • 推荐:wget、tar、grep
    • 用途:用于下载文件、解压文件、搜索文本等。
  4. 构建工具(可选):

    • 推荐:Maven、Gradle
    • 用途:用于自动化构建和管理Java项目。
  5. 集成开发环境(IDE)(可选):

    • 推荐:Eclipse、IntelliJ IDEA
    • 用途:提供图形化界面进行Java开发。
  6. 版本控制工具

    • 推荐:Git
    • 用途:如果使用源码进行编译,可能需要版本控制工具来管理源码。
  7. Tomcat(如果开发Web应用):

    • 推荐版本:Tomcat 9
    • 安装方法
      • 下载Tomcat安装包:
        wget https://downloads.apache.org/tomcat/tomcat-9/v9.0.56/bin/apache-tomcat-9.0.56.tar.gz
        
      • 解压安装包:
        tar -zxvf apache-tomcat-9.0.56.tar.gz
        
      • 移动解压后的文件夹到合适的位置(例如/usr/local/tomcat):
        sudo mv apache-tomcat-9.0.56 /usr/local/tomcat
        
      • 配置环境变量:
        • 编辑/etc/profile文件:
          sudo vi /etc/profile
          
        • 在文件末尾添加以下内容(替换为实际的Tomcat安装路径):
          export CATALINA_HOME=/usr/local/tomcat
          export PATH=$CATALINA_HOME/bin:$PATH
          
        • 使环境变量生效:
          source /etc/profile
          
      • 启动和测试Tomcat:
        cd /usr/local/tomcat/bin
        ./startup.sh
        
        在浏览器中访问http://localhost:8080来验证是否安装成功。

通过以上步骤,你可以在CentOS系统上配置一个完整的Java开发环境。这些工具和步骤涵盖了从安装JDK到配置环境变量,以及安装和配置必要的构建工具和IDE。

0
看了该问题的人还看了